What is a Contingency Fee?
A contingency fee agreement is an alternative way of paying for legal services. Unlike the traditional hourly billing method, with a contingency fee, you typically don't pay any upfront costs or ongoing fees for your lawyer's time. Instead, your lawyer's fee is "contingent" upon the outcome of your case.

How Contingency Fees Work in Personal Injury Cases:
In a personal injury case with a contingency fee agreement, Iacobelli Law Firm will:
  • Not require any upfront payment: You won't have to pay a retainer or any hourly fees as your case progresses.
  • Cover case expenses: We will typically advance the costs associated with your case, such as filing fees, obtaining medical records, expert witness fees, and other necessary expenses.
  • Collect a fee only if we win: If we successfully obtain a settlement or win a judgment in your favor, we will receive a percentage of the recovery as our fee. This percentage will be agreed upon in advance and outlined in the contingency fee agreement.
  • No recovery, no fee: If, for any reason, we are unable to secure a favorable outcome in your case, you will not owe us any legal fees.

Benefits of Contingency Fees in Personal Injury Cases:
  • Access to justice: Contingency fees make it possible for individuals who might not otherwise be able to afford legal representation to pursue their personal injury claims.
  • Reduced financial risk: You don't have to worry about paying hourly fees or covering expenses out-of-pocket, which minimizes your financial risk.
  • Aligned interests: Contingency fee agreements align the interests of the lawyer and the client. We are both invested in achieving the best possible outcome for your case.
  • Focus on recovery: With the financial burden lifted, you can focus on healing and recovering from your injuries, while we handle the legal complexities of your case.

Beyond Personal Injury:
While contingency fees are most commonly associated with personal injury cases, they can also be used in other types of civil litigation, such as contract disputes or financial loss claims.
